CHESS OLYMPIADS

year / venue / chess pieces

1927 (London, England) / -
1928  (The Hague, Netherlands) / -
1930 (Hamburg, Germany) / -
1931 (Prague, Chechoslovakia) / Česká Klubovka" (Czech Club Set)
1933 (Folkestone, England) / -
1935 (Warsaw, Poland) / -
*1936 (Munich, Germany) unofficial / Bundesform Chess Set
1937 (Stockholm, Sweden) / -
1939 (Buenos Aires, Argentina ) / Olímpico Magistral 1939 - Piezas de Ajedrez
1950 (Dubrovnik, Yugoslavia) / Dubrovnik 1950 Chess Set
1952 (Helsinki, Finland) / -
1954 (Amsterdam, Netherlands) / -
1956 (Moscow, USSR) / Soviet Chess Set (Botvinnik-Flor II)
1958 (Munich, Germany) / -
1960 (Leipzig, DDR / Leipzig Olympiad Chess Set (Bayerwald Chess Set)
1962 (Varna, Bulgaria) / Varna 1962 Chess Set
1964 (Tel Aviv, Israel) / -
1966 (Havana, Cuba) / Havana 1966 Chess Set
1968 (Lugano, Switzerland) / -
1970 (Siegen, FRD) / Olympiad 1970 Chess Set (Bohemia Chess Set)
1972 (Skopje, Yugoslavia) / Skopje 1972 Chess Set
1974 (Nice, France) / Lardy 1974 Chess Set
1976 (Haifa, Israel) / -
1978 (Buenos Aires, Argentina ) / Ajedrez Olimpico Argentino
1980 (Valletta, Malta) / -
1982 (Lucerne, Switzerland) / Lardy 1982 Chess Set
1984 (Thessaloniki, Greece) / -
1986 (Dubai, UAE) / -
1988 (Thessaloniki, Greece) / -
1990 (Novi Sad, Yugoslavia) / Dubrovnik Chess Set (Subozan factory Chess)
1992 (Manila, Philippines) / Manila 1992 Chess Set
1994 (Moscow, Russia) / Soviet Chess Set ( GM 4 )
1996 (Erevan, Armenia) / Dubrovnik Chess Set (plastic)
1998 (Elista, Russia) / DGT Classic Chess Pieces (Reykjavik ll Chess Set)
2000 (Istanbul, Turkey) / German Knight Staunton
2002 (Bled, Slovenia) / German Knight Staunton
2004 (Calvia, Spain) / HoS Championship Series Chess Set
2006 (Torino, Italy) / German Knight Staunton
2008 (Dresden, Germany) / German Knight Staunton
2010 (Khanty-Mansiysk, Russia ) German Knight Staunton (DGT Timeless)
2012 (Istanbul, Turkey) / DGT Classic Chess Pieces (Reykjavik ll Chess Set) / German Knight Staunton
2014 (Tromso, Norway) German Knight Staunton (DGT Timeless)
2016 (Baku, Azerbaijan) / German Knight Staunton (DGT Timeless)
2018 (Batumi, Georgia) / German Knight Staunton (DGT Timeless)
2022 (Chennai, India) / DGT Chess Pieces Plastic

1st Chess Olympiad 1927 London

Staunton Chess Set (Jaques of London) 1920-1930s.

Chess pieces played at the 1927 Chess Olympiad

The 1st Chess Olympiad took place between 18 and 30 July, 1927 at the Westminster Central Hall, London, United Kingdom.

The 1st Women's World Chess Championship also took place during the time of the olympiad.

Source: Wiener Bilder, 31 July 1927, page 6. Our correspondent identifies the photograph as taken during the first round of the 1927 Olympiad in London (Austria v Finland, with S.R. Wolf (White) and J. Terho in the foreground).

Katarina Beskow (left) plays Agnes Stevenson. This is a posed photo as neither was due to play each other on the day that it must have been taken, 18 July 1927, which was the first day of the inaugural Women's World Chess Championship tournament at Central Hall, Westminster, London. Photo from the Daily Mirror, 19 July 1927.

The photo clearly shows the chess pieces that were played at the 1927 Chess Olympiad, and at the Women's World Championship 1927.
